Impact Costs Clause Samples

The Impact Costs clause defines how additional expenses resulting from unforeseen events or changes are handled within a contract. It typically outlines which party is responsible for bearing these costs, such as increased labor, materials, or delays caused by factors outside the original agreement. By clearly allocating responsibility for such costs, this clause helps prevent disputes and ensures both parties understand their financial obligations if project conditions change.
Impact Costs. Up to one-half of one percent (0.5%) of the net win derived from Tribal Lottery System activities, determined on an annual basis using the Tribe’s fiscal year, shall be added to any amounts payable and distributable from other Class III activities under the Compact in order to meet community impacts, to the extent such Compact amounts are insufficient to meet actual and demonstrated impact costs.

Impact Costs. No claim for impact costs resulting from the performance of a Change Order will be permitted against the Owner, the Architect, or any other party in privity of contract with the Owner with respect to the Project after the time the Change Order is signed by the CMAR.
